General Information

  • Type of Jurisdiction: Archdiocese
  • Elevated: 29 June 1951
  • Metropolitan See
  • Rite: Latin (or Roman)
  • Country: Philippines
  • Square Kilometers: 3,799 (1,467 Square Miles)
  • Description: Comprises two civil provinces, Misamis Oriental and Camiguin, an island province to the north, and a town in Bukidnon

Historical Summary

DateEventFromTo
Diocese of Cagayan de Oro
20 January 1933ErectedDiocese of Zamboanga (Surigao (with islands of Dinagat and Siargao), Agusom, Eastern Misamis (with island of Camiguin), Western Misamis, Bukidnon, and Southern part of Lanao) Diocese of Cagayan de Oro (erected)
28 April 1934Metropolitan ChangedDiocese of Cagayan de Oro (from Manila)
3 June 1939Territory LostDiocese of Cagayan de Oro (Provinces of Surigao and Agusan) Diocese of Surigao (erected)
27 January 1951Territory LostDiocese of Cagayan de Oro (Provinces of Lanao and Misamis Occiental) Territorial Prelature of Ozamis (erected)
Archdiocese of Cagayan de Oro
29 June 1951ElevatedDiocese of Cagayan de Oro Archdiocese of Cagayan de Oro
25 April 1969Territory LostArchdiocese of Cagayan de Oro (Bukidnon) Territorial Prelature of Malaybalay (erected)
